Top Stack Group has been retained by an biopharma company with HQ in Norristown, PA to assist them in hiring a Full Stack Developer (Java) to join their team. This is a full-time, salaried position with a competitive base salary, annual bonus and a comprehensive benefits package. This position is 5 days/week in office where you will sit with the rest of the App Dev Team.

 

As a Full Stack App Developer, you will design, develop, and maintain enterprise applications. The ideal candidate should have strong expertise in Java, Spring Boot, Microservices, Frontend Technologies (Angular), Oracle DB, and Cloud Platforms (AWS/GCP/Azure), and DevOps practices. If you are at the Lead Developer level, you will help guide junior team members on best ensure best coding practices, and drive the successful delivery of projects.

 

Essential Functions:
  • Collaborate with business analysts and product owners to define technical requirements.
  • Architect and implement scalable, high-performance applications using Java (Spring Boot) and Microservices.
  • Ensure code quality, maintainability, and security through code reviews, best practices, and design patterns.
  • Drive agile methodologies, including scrum ceremonies, sprint planning, and retrospectives.
  • Take ownership of the full software development lifecycle (SDLC), from design to deployment.
  • Develop and maintain RESTful APIs and Microservices using Spring Boot, Jersey, and Hibernate.
  • Implement asynchronous messaging with Apache Kafka/RabbitMQ.
  • Work with Oracle databases for optimized data storage and retrieval.
  • Develop responsive, interactive UI components using Angular and modern JavaScript frameworks
  • Integrate UI components with RESTful APIs.
  • Deploy applications on AWS/GCP/Azure with CI/CD pipelines (Jenkins, Bitbucket, GitHub Actions, GitLab CI/CD)
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(QA, DevOps, Security) to ensure seamless delivery.

 

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Information Technology or related field.
  • 3+ years of development experience including backend and frontend.
  • Java, Spring Boot, Microservices, Frontend Technologies (Angular), Oracle DB, and Cloud Platforms (AWS/GCP/Azure), and DevOps practices.
  • Strong problem-solving and debugging skills.
  • Ability to work on site 5 days/week
